Frequently Asked Questions about Hartford

How much are Studio apartments in Hartford?

There are currently 885 Studio Apartments in Hartford with rent ranges from $835 to $3,002 with an average price of $1,573.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Hartford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Hartford ranges from $950 to $4,100 with an average monthly rent of $1,989.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Hartford c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Hartford range from $1,072 to $5,135.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,464.

How expensive are Hartford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 351 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Hartford on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,250 to $6,045 - averaging $2,416 for the location.
